机械设计制造在农业机械化发展中的作用研究

摘    要


  随着我国农业现代化进程的加快,农业机械化水平成为影响农业生产效率和质量的关键因素,机械设计制造在其中发挥着不可替代的作用。本研究旨在探讨机械设计制造对农业机械化发展的推动作用,以期为农业机械化发展提供理论支持和技术指导。机械设计制造创新能够显著提升农业机械性能,如精准设计可使播种机播种精度提高30%,智能控制技术让收割机作业效率提升25%。同时,新材料的应用有效降低了设备自重并增强了耐用性。本研究创新点在于将先进设计理念引入传统农机制造领域,强调智能化、绿色化发展方向,提出构建基于物联网的农机运维管理系统,实现远程监控与故障预警,为农业机械化向高质量发展转型提供了新思路,主要贡献是为农业机械设计制造优化升级指明方向,促进农业生产力进一步解放与发展。



关键词:农业机械化  机械设计制造  智能化  新材料应用




Abstract

  With the acceleration of China's agricultural modernization process, the level of agricultural mechanization has become a key factor affecting the efficiency and quality of agricultural production, and mechanical design and manufacturing play an irreplaceable role in it. The purpose of this study is to explore the role of mechanical design and manufacturing in promoting the development of agricultural mechanization, in order to provide theoretical support and technical guidance for the development of agricultural mechanization. Mechanical design and manufacturing innovation can significantly improve the performance of agricultural machinery, such as precision design can increase the seeding accuracy of the seeder by 30%, and intelligent control technology can increase the efficiency of the harvester by 25%. At the same time, the application of new materials effectively reduces the weight of the equipment and enhances the durability. The innovation point of this research is to introduce advanced design concepts into the field of traditional agricultural machinery manufacturing, emphasize the direction of intelligent and green development, propose the construction of agricultural machinery operation and maintenance management system based on the Internet of Things, realize remote monitoring and fault warning, and provide new ideas for the transformation of agricultural mechanization to high-quality development. The main contribution is to point out the direction for the optimization and upgrading of agricultural machinery design and manufacturing. We will further liberate and develop agricultural productive forces.


Keyword:Agricultural Mechanization  Mechanical Design And Manufacturing  Intelligence  New Materials Application
